spark自定义udf函数 group by和聚合函数用法?

group by和聚合函数用法?选择列表项中不存在的列可以出现在group by的列表项中,反之亦然。选择列表项中出现的所有列必须出现在group by(聚合函数除外)之后group by通常只有在与

group by和聚合函数用法?

选择列表项中不存在的列可以出现在group by的列表项中,反之亦然。选择列表项中出现的所有列必须出现在group by(聚合函数除外)之后

group by通常只有在与聚合函数(如count sum AVG)一起使用时才有意义,它使用分组依据的两个元素:

(1)在聚合函数或分组依据中选择后显示的字段。

(2)要筛选结果,可以使用where first和group by,或group by first和having